Feb 21 (Reuters) - An Arizona prosecutor said on Wednesday she will decline an extradition request from New York for a man wanted for the murder of a woman in a hotel room because she did not trust her Manhattan counterpart to keep the man in custody.
Maricopa County Attorney Rachel Mitchell, a Republican, said at a press conference she had instructed her staff not to cooperate with any request by Manhattan District Attorney Alvin Bragg, a Democrat, to extradite Raad Noan Almansoori. The announcement drew criticism from Bragg's office that Mitchell was playing "political games" in a murder case.
Almansoori is wanted for the murder of Denisse Oleas-Arancibia, 38, in a room at the SoHo 54 Hotel in Manhattan earlier in February. She was strangled and bludgeoned in her head, according to an autopsy report.
He was arrested by police in Scottsdale, Arizona, on Feb. 18 after an 18-year-old woman survived being stabbed multiple times in the bathroom of a McDonald's restaurant in Surprise, Arizona.
He made statements to Arizona investigators linking himself to the McDonald's attack, another non-fatal stabbing the day before in Phoenix, Arizona, and the murder at the SoHo 54 Hotel, police said.
Almansoori remains in jail, having been denied release on bail at an initial court appearance, and it was unclear whether he had a lawyer.
In explaining her decision not to extradite Almansoori to New York, Mitchell, the county's chief prosecutor, noted that the assaults he is accused of in Arizona carry mandatory prison sentences, suggesting without evidence he might be released from custody in New York.
"Having observed the treatment of violent criminals in the New York area by the Manhattan D.A. there, Alvin Bragg, I think it's safer to keep him here and keep him in custody so that he cannot be out doing this to individuals, either in our state or county or anywhere in the United States," she told reporters.
She did not elaborate, but Bragg, like other Democratic law-enforcement officials, has often been criticized by Republican politicians for being too lenient on criminals, even where such allegations are undercut by crime statistics.
Bragg's office shared data showing the murder rate in Phoenix, the largest city in Maricopa County, is more than twice that of New York City, which has long had a relatively low ranking among American cities for violent crime.
"It is deeply disturbing that D.A. Mitchell is playing political games in a murder investigation," Emily Tuttle, a spokesperson for the Manhattan district attorney, said in a statement. She said Mitchell's decision was a "slap in the face" to New York law enforcement and "to the victim in our case to refuse to allow us to seek justice and full accountability for a New Yorker's death."

(CNN) -- The Defense Department will reopen its investigation into employees who are alleged to have downloaded child pornography, a spokesman said Wednesday.
The Pentagon's Defense Criminal Investigative Service will review 264 cases, according to spokesman Gary Comerford. The department had stopped the reviews because of a lack of resources, he said.
Some of the cases may be referred to military criminal investigations, while cases where it appears a criminal investigation cannot be done will be sent to Defense Department leadership for consideration.
The incidents were part of Project Flicker, a nationwide child pornography sting conducted several years ago by Immigration and Customs Enforcement agents. The Department of Defense released documents pertaining to the sting earlier this summer.
A Yahoo News investigation found that the department followed up on only a fifth of the cases after federal investigators informed it of employee involvement.
"I have tasked Defense Criminal Investigative Service representatives with reviewing each and every Project Flicker and related referral DCIS received so as to ensure action was taken regarding these allegations involving employees of the Department of Defense," James Burch, deputy inspector general for investigations, said in a statement released Wednesday.
Among the employees identified in a series of reports released by the department were some listed as having security clearances at the top secret level or higher. They worked for groups within the department such as the National Security Agency and the National Reconnaissance Office, two of the country's top intelligence agencies.
Some of the employees are suspected of having used their work computers to view pornographic websites.
Some employees involved in the investigation have pleaded guilty to charges of child pornography, but other inquiries were dropped or are still open. One case against a Defense Department contractor who allegedly admitted to having viewed pornographic material of children was dropped "due to a lack of resources," according to one of the reports from 2009.

Most children and adolescents do not have COVID-19 antibodies in their blood after recovering from a coronavirus infection, new data has confirmed.
Starting in October 2020, researchers in the US state of Texas recruited 218 subjects between the ages of five and 19 who had recovered from COVID infections at some point in the past.
Each provided three blood samples, at three-month intervals.
More than 90 per cent were unvaccinated when they enrolled in the study.
The first blood test showed infection-related antibodies in only one-third of the children, the researchers reported, while six months later only half of those with the antibodies still had them.
The study was designed to detect the presence of antibodies, which are only one component of the immune system's defences, not the amount of antibodies.
The level of protection even in those with antibodies is unclear.
Researchers found no differences based on whether a child was asymptomatic, severity of symptoms, when they had the virus or due to weight or gender.
"It was the same for everyone," Sarah Messiah of UTHealth School of Public Health Dallas, said in a statement.
"Some parents ... think just because their child has had COVID-19, they are now protected and don't need to get the vaccine.
"We have a great tool available to give children additional protection by getting their vaccine."

The fire on Saturday afternoon occurred at a storehouse in the southern town of Viviez, in Aveyron, where 900 tons of lithium batteries were waiting to be recycled.
Authorities ordered residents to stay indoors and keep their windows closed as thick smoke billowed over the town. No injuries or deaths were reported and the cause of the fire has yet to be established.
Lithium batteries, found in electric scooters and vacuum cleaners, are known to spontaneously combust if they overheat or become damaged. Their dangers have raised concerns in countries where e-bikes have been promoted as a climate-friendly mode of transportation.
Questions raised
Jean-Louis Denoit, the mayor of Viviez, called Saturday’s fire “shocking” and told French news channel BFMTV: “Behind all this, there is indeed reason to ask questions about the function of electric vehicles and lithium batteries.”
It took 70 firefighters to put the fire under control, after which air quality tests were conducted and the lockdown order lifted.
France has moved to promote cycling since the pandemic, with e-bikes becoming hugely popular in cities like Paris. However irresponsible behaviour and a rising number of accidents has led to criticism around their use, and how to store their batteries safely.
In the UK, a proposal to build one of Europe’s largest battery storage facilities near the village of Granborough, in Buckinghamshire, was met with fierce opposition by locals who have expressed environmental and safety concerns.
The plan, by the energy company Statera, calls for a 500 MW battery energy storage system that would span 26 acres of land.
Responding to the plans, the Claydon Solar Action Group wrote on social media: “Unacceptable risks of fire, explosion, air and water pollution, a major accident waiting to happen just 500 metres away from residential properties.”

SARS-CoV-2 (severe acute respiratory syndrome coronavirus 2) is the virus that causes coronavirus disease 2019 (COVID-19). Globally, numerous vaccines have been developed against COVID-19. In the United States, three vaccines for COVID-19 have been authorized or approved by the US Food and Drug Administration (FDA): Pfizer-BioNTech, Moderna, and Johnson & Johnson. The majority of patients in the US have received either the Pfizer-BioNTech or Moderna vaccines, but all three are highly effective in preventing serious disease, hospitalization, and death from COVID-19. Although certain side effects may occur, the benefits greatly outweigh the risks.
In the United Kingdom, Australia, and other countries (but not in the US), a vaccine produced by AstraZeneca has been widely administered. Though it is also effective, it has certain rare but unique side effects as discussed below. Nevertheless, its benefits still greatly outweigh its risks.
Important differences in the manufacturing process distinguish these vaccines from one another. The Pfizer-BioNTech and Moderna vaccines are both nucleoside-modified mRNA, encoding the viral spike (S) glycoprotein of SARS-CoV-2. The Johnson & Johnson vaccine comprises a recombinant, replication-incompetent Ad26 vector, encoding a stabilized variant of the S protein. Similarly, the AstraZeneca vaccine is a replication-deficient modified adenovirus ChAdOx1, containing the coding sequence of the S protein.
Put simply, the Pfizer-BioNTech and Moderna vaccines are mRNA vaccines, whereas the Johnson & Johnson and AstraZeneca vaccines are adenovirus-vector vaccines.
Are the COVID-19 vaccines safe?
Over 400 million doses of COVID-19 vaccine have been given in the US, with almost 7 billion doses administered worldwide. For the vast majority of people, including those with vascular disease, the benefits of vaccination against COVID-19 overwhelmingly outweigh any risks. These vaccines are undergoing continuous and intense safety monitoring. Across numerous clinical trials, the vaccines have been shown to be safe and effective, and they clearly reduce the risk of serious infection, hospitalization, and death related to COVID-19.
Although rare side effects have been reported with these vaccines, these events occur much less frequently than the often severe and life-threatening complications that occur with COVID-19. In summary, these vaccines are safe and effective.
What are the common side effects of COVID-19 vaccines?
The COVID-19 vaccines have been subjected to some of the most intense monitoring in medical history. In the US, this includes monitoring through the Vaccine Adverse Event Reporting System (VAERS), which is a national early warning system that the US FDA uses to monitor the safety of vaccines after they are authorized or licensed for use. VAERS helps to detect unusual or unexpected reporting patterns of adverse events for vaccines.

A bipartisan majority in the U.S. Senate voted 70-to-29 to advance a $95 billion dollar foreign aid package, despite warnings from House Republicans that the bill may never receive a vote.
The package contains no changes to U.S. border policy, despite early insistence by Republicans that they would not support foreign aid provisions — which provide military support for Ukraine, Israel, and Taiwan — without substantial changes to the Biden administration's border policies.
But after months of bipartisan negotiation produced a border-plus-foreign-aid deal unveiled earlier this month, the plan withered in a matter of days. Many Republican senators announced their opposition to the 300-plus page bill within hours of its release. Some stated explicitly that they hoped to preserve the border crisis as an issue for the 2024 campaign season and echoed concerns about the deal raised by GOP presidential front-runner Donald Trump.
Now House Republicans, who rejected the previous bipartisan deal for failing to meet hard-line demands on border provisions, say they will also reject the stand-alone security funding.
House Speaker Mike Johnson, R-La., released a statement Monday night well before the final vote was scheduled in the Senate.
"The mandate of national security supplemental legislation was to secure America's own border before sending additional foreign aid around the world," Johnson wrote. "It is what the American people demand and deserve. Now, in the absence of having received any single border policy change from the Senate, the House will have to continue to work its own will on these important matters. America deserves better than the Senate's status quo."
Senate forges ahead with military aid amid pressure from Trump
This foreign aid focused bill was released last week after the border agreement failed. The plan started with the support of House Minority Leader Mitch McConnell, R-Ky, and other GOP defense hawks who worry that U.S. allies face serious threats without adequate funding.
But support for that view has been eroding among Republicans under pressure from former President Donald Trump who said during a campaign rally this weekend that he would not defend NATO allies against attacks from Russia if those allies do not meet his definition of paying enough money for defense.
"If we don't pay and we're attacked by Russia, will you protect us?" Trump recalled another country's leader asking while him while he was president. "No, I would not protect you. In fact, I would encourage them to do whatever the hell they want."
McConnell defended U.S. investments in NATO and other allies in a lengthy speech on the Senate floor following Trump's remarks.
"We haven't equipped the brave people of Ukraine, Israel, or Taiwan with lethal capabilities in order to win philanthropic accolades," McConnell said. "We're not urgently strengthening defenses in the Indo-Pacific because it feels good. We don't wield American strength frivolously. We do it because it is in our own interest. We equip our friends to face our shared adversaries so we're less likely to have to spend American lives to defeat them."
But many of McConnell's GOP members still lined up to vehemently oppose the bill. A group led by Sen. Rand Paul, R-Ky., gave lengthy speeches to delay Senate proceedings, despite the clear reality that the bill easily had the votes to pass.
The process coincided with a major national security conference in Munich, where top government officials representing America's major allies were closely following the Senate's process.
